Output 4064d51dee17aec351f674d90606602f6b5056b3d140c80d58842684b1bb185f:0

value
15084997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ebab833c8538b3880cc89fc779bbfc260a437a5 OP_EQUAL
address
MF5Sctoqc4DGr1dEYXEe3mw9i342MQA578
transaction
4064d51dee17aec351f674d90606602f6b5056b3d140c80d58842684b1bb185f
spent
true